AI-Generated Summary

The landscape of online entrepreneurship has undergone a seismic shift since 2008, rendering many once-reliable strategies obsolete. Pat Flynn, host of the Smart Passive Income podcast, takes listeners on a deep dive into how content creation, marketing, and business building have evolved—from the blog-first, SEO-driven tactics of the early 2010s to today’s hyper-competitive, attention-scarce environment dominated by short-form video, community, and authenticity. What worked then—keyword stuffing, passive email blasts, and waiting for Google traffic—no longer delivers. Instead, success now hinges on being human, building relationships, and leveraging platforms like TikTok, Instagram Reels, and YouTube Shorts as the new SEO. The rise of the creator economy, real-time engagement, and data-driven personalization has made consistency, vulnerability, and community-building essential. Yet, despite the complexity, the core principles remain: help people, solve problems, and connect genuinely. The real opportunity isn’t in being first—it’s in being specific, authentic, and focused. With the right tools and mindset, anyone can build a thriving business today—even from a smartphone. The episode dismantles outdated mental models and replaces them with a modern framework: start with one platform, create consistently, build a community, and own your audience through email and membership.

Key Takeaways
1

Stop chasing SEO keywords—today’s success comes from creating video content that captures attention on TikTok, Instagram Reels, and YouTube Shorts.

2

People follow people, not brands—authenticity, vulnerability, and storytelling are now your biggest competitive advantages.

3

Build your audience on social media, but own your list: use platforms to drive traffic to your email or community, which you control.

4

The 'blog-first' strategy is dead—today’s content strategy is video-first, multi-platform, and repurposed across 5–10 channels.

5

Community is the new revenue engine: engaged communities drive referrals, loyalty, and multiple income streams beyond products.

The 2008 Business Blueprint: A Lost Era

Pat recounts his 2008 journey—building a niche blog from a $10 domain, ranking for keywords, and earning six figures in a year using simple SEO and link-building tactics.

2:59
3 min

The Old World: SEO, Email, and Product Launches

Breakdown of 2008-era strategies: keyword-stuffed blog posts, lead magnets, email blasts, and long-form product launches with high conversion rates.

5:59
3 min

The 2010s Revolution: Algorithmic Shifts & Mobile Rise

Google’s Panda and Penguin updates killed keyword stuffing. Mobile usage exploded, attention spans shortened, and social media became essential.

8:59
3 min

The Trust Recession & Creator Economy Explosion

As scams and low-quality content flooded the web, authenticity became a competitive advantage. The creator economy, worth $104B, now enables monetization through sponsorships, communities, and live streams.
